#7f6d5f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7f6d5f is composed of 49.8% red, 42.7% green and 37.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 14.2% magenta, 25.2% yellow and 50.2% black. It has a hue angle of 26.3 degrees, a saturation of 14.4% and a lightness of 43.5%. #7f6d5f color hex could be obtained by blending #fedabe with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#7f6d5f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040303 is the darkest color, while #f9f8f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#7f6d5f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#766e68 is the less saturated color, while #dd6101 is the most saturated one.
